Pampy: The Pattern Matching for Python you always dreamed of.
-
Updated
Apr 11, 2020 - Python
Pampy: The Pattern Matching for Python you always dreamed of.
An Open Source Implementation of the Actor Model in C++
Pattern Matching for Javascript
STUMPY is a powerful and scalable Python library for computing a Matrix Profile, which can be used for a variety of time series data mining tasks
Functional programming style pattern-matching library for C++
The Egison Programming Language
Super tiny and ~350% faster alternative to node-glob
Pampy.js: Pattern Matching for JavaScript
Tools for transparent data transformation
This is an experimental library that has evolved to P1371, proposed for C++23.
A macro to define clojure functions with parameter pattern matching just like erlang or elixir.
In this article I try to explain why Haskell keeps being such an important language by presenting some of its most important and distinguishing features and detailing them with working code examples. The presentation aims to be self-contained and does not require any previous knowledge of the language.
Qo - Query Object - Pattern matching and fluent querying in Ruby
The implementation of the Rascal meta-programming language (including interpreter, type checker, parser generator, compiler and JVM based run-time system)
Variable assignment with zeal! (or multiple, unpacking, and destructuring assignment in R)
Julia functional programming infrastructures and metaprogramming facilities
Distributed Graph Analytics with Apache Flink
First-class patterns for Clojure. Made with love, functions, and just the right amount of syntax.
A Ruby gem for non-linear pattern-matching with backtracking
Eval is a lightweight interpreter framework written in Swift, evaluating expressions at runtime
Monad, Functional Programming features for Golang
Reusable, composable patterns across Elixir libraries
Rosie Pattern Language (RPL) and the Rosie Pattern Engine have MOVED!
bem-xjst (eXtensible JavaScript Templates): declarative template engine for the browser and server
Zeronode - minimal building block for NodeJS microservices
Add a description, image, and links to the pattern-matching topic page so that developers can more easily learn about it.
To associate your repository with the pattern-matching topic, visit your repo's landing page and select "manage topics."